Albright Speaks Hyperbole?
Former Secretary of State Madeleine Albright had a mouthful to say about President Bush and foreign policy. She made these remarks on Thursday night:
"President Bush's Plan B is to leave this for the next president," "Iraq will go down as the greatest disaster in American foreign policy, bigger than Vietnam -- which is quite a statement... Everybody has talked about the problem of a unilateral foreign policy," she told about 150 attendees, "but we have a unidimensional foreign policy (in) using only one tool, military force... President Bush's Plan B is to leave this for the next president."
Albright, while campaigning for Hillary, has certainly gone overboard with the hyperbole. The greatest disaster in American foreign policy? Yikes... but I doubt it.
